**Test Plan: Undo/Redo in SketchLoom**

Cover the usual suspects: single-step undo, redo after undo, and the history-truncation case where a new edit after undo discards the redo stack. Pay attention to grouped moves — multi-select drags must undo as one step. Run the suite against the Harrowfield staging instance. To authenticate the automated runner against staging, use the bearer token below.

portal login ticket: eyJhbGciOiJIUzI1NiIsInR5cCI6IkpXVCJ9.eyJzdWIiOiIwEOsktwVNwIn0.-UJU3fdyyCgG

**Ticket AR-771: Cold storage archive job stalls on Glacierfen buckets**

For the weekly eng sync: the nightly archiver for Pondera cold buckets halts at roughly 60% when manifests exceed 10k objects. Suspected pagination bug in the lister. Workaround: split manifests manually. Fix targeted for next sprint. The failing run's trace token follows for reference.

session token of tajef-bageg = htk21_5d90d574934f3ccae6437

**Q: The Harwick Labs intern cohort arrives Monday — what does facilities need to do?**

Twelve interns start at the Brindlemoor site, orientation at 09:00 in the Fenwick Room. Permanent badges won't be printed until Wednesday, so issue day passes at the desk each morning and collect them at sign-out. Interns may not access Lab Wing C or the roof terrace under any circumstances. Escort is required after 18:00. For the shared training room, the group uses a single temporary entry code.

door code, bagef-yafop: bdg-ZFZML-07646